The Garmin Forerunner 55 is a reliable GPS running watch that offers up to two weeks of battery life in smartwatch mode. This makes it a great choice for runners who don't want to worry about frequent charging.
Its PacePro feature provides GPS-based pace guidance, helping runners plan their race day strategy effectively. This is particularly useful for those training for marathons or other long-distance events.
The watch includes advanced wellness features like fitness age, all-day respiration tracking, and intensity minutes. These tools help users tune into their body and optimise their training routines.
With built-in activity profiles for running, cycling, swimming, and more, the Forerunner 55 caters to a variety of fitness enthusiasts. The Connect IQ Store allows for further customisation with free watch faces and apps.
Suggested workouts based on training history and fitness level take the guesswork out of training. This feature is ideal for beginners or those looking to improve their performance systematically.
The Garmin Venu Sq 2 features a bright AMOLED display with an always-on mode, making it easy to read at a glance. This is perfect for users who want quick access to their health and fitness data.
With up to 11 days of battery life in smartwatch mode, this watch provides a comprehensive 24/7 picture of your health. This extended battery life is a significant advantage for continuous monitoring.
The watch includes Garmin Pay, allowing users to make contactless payments on the go. This feature adds convenience for those who want to leave their wallet at home during workouts.
Over 25 built-in indoor and GPS sports apps cater to a wide range of activities, from running to swimming. The preloaded workouts and Garmin Coach plans offer additional training support.
Health monitoring features like Body Battery energy levels, sleep score, and stress tracking provide valuable insights. This makes the Venu Sq 2 a well-rounded choice for health-conscious individuals.

A GPS running watch is a specialised wearable device designed to track and analyse your running performance with pinpoint accuracy. These watches use Global Positioning System (GPS) technology to measure distance, pace, and route mapping in real time.
Modern GPS running watches go beyond basic tracking, offering advanced metrics like cadence, stride length, and heart rate monitoring. They serve as comprehensive training partners for runners of all levels, from beginners to elite athletes.
The best models feature long battery life, waterproof designs, and smart connectivity to sync with your smartphone. They help runners set goals, monitor progress, and adjust training plans based on data-driven insights.
When choosing a GPS running watch, consider your specific training needs and the watch's compatibility with your preferred running apps. The right watch can significantly enhance your training efficiency and running experience.
